如何设置VSCode实现代码自动格式化及对齐功能?
- 内容介绍
- 文章标签
- 相关推荐
本文共计3459个文字,预计阅读时间需要14分钟。
VSCode 提升代码对齐和格式化效率,关键在于利用其内置功能和扩展。最直接的方法是使用快捷键触发生动格式化,或配置自动保存时格式化,确保代码始终保持整洁和一致性。
VSCode实现代码对齐和格式化,主要通过以下几种方式:
-
手动触发格式化:
- 在Windows/Linux上,按下
Shift + Alt + F。
- 在macOS上,按下
Shift + Option + F。
- 这会根据当前文件类型和已安装的格式化器(formatter)对整个文档进行格式化。如果你只选中了部分代码,则只会格式化选中区域。
- 在Windows/Linux上,按下
-
配置保存时自动格式化:
- 这是我个人最推荐的方式,可以省去每次手动按快捷键的麻烦。
- 打开VSCode设置(
Ctrl + , 或
Cmd + ,)。
- 搜索
editor.formatOnSave,勾选它。
- 你还可以搜索
editor.defaultFormatter 来指定一个默认的格式化器。例如,如果你主要写JavaScript/TypeScript,可以设置为
esbenp.prettier-vscode (Prettier扩展的ID)。
- 对于某些语言,你可能需要安装特定的格式化扩展,比如Python的
ms-python.python(内置了Black/autopep8等选项),或者JavaScript/TypeScript的Prettier。
本文共计3459个文字,预计阅读时间需要14分钟。
VSCode 提升代码对齐和格式化效率,关键在于利用其内置功能和扩展。最直接的方法是使用快捷键触发生动格式化,或配置自动保存时格式化,确保代码始终保持整洁和一致性。
VSCode实现代码对齐和格式化,主要通过以下几种方式:
-
手动触发格式化:
- 在Windows/Linux上,按下
Shift + Alt + F。
- 在macOS上,按下
Shift + Option + F。
- 这会根据当前文件类型和已安装的格式化器(formatter)对整个文档进行格式化。如果你只选中了部分代码,则只会格式化选中区域。
- 在Windows/Linux上,按下
-
配置保存时自动格式化:
- 这是我个人最推荐的方式,可以省去每次手动按快捷键的麻烦。
- 打开VSCode设置(
Ctrl + , 或
Cmd + ,)。
- 搜索
editor.formatOnSave,勾选它。
- 你还可以搜索
editor.defaultFormatter 来指定一个默认的格式化器。例如,如果你主要写JavaScript/TypeScript,可以设置为
esbenp.prettier-vscode (Prettier扩展的ID)。
- 对于某些语言,你可能需要安装特定的格式化扩展,比如Python的
ms-python.python(内置了Black/autopep8等选项),或者JavaScript/TypeScript的Prettier。

